Revisit of the Danish River Basin Management Plans 2021
2027
(RBMP3)
Dear Ms. Manfredi, dear all,
To follow-up on the implementation of the Water Framework Directive, I would like
to update you on the process with the revisit of the Danish River Basin Management
Plans 2021-2027.
In July, the Permanent Secretary for the Danish Ministry of Environment informed
Director General Florika Fink-Hoijer on the status of implementing measures for
coastal waters based on the
Agreement on a Green Denmark
which was agreed
upon by the Danish Government and Stakeholders on 26 June.
On 18 November, the Government and majority of the Parliament agreed on ‘The
Agreement on Implementation of a Green Denmark’ to put on top of the tripartite
agreement. In between the two agreements, a new Ministry of Green Transition has
been established with just one task and one task only
to implement that
agreement. Now we have a concrete masterplan and secured broad political
consensus for how to reach good ecological status in the fjords and coastal waters.
Central to the agreement is a large-scale conversion of the use of the Danish land
whereby a significant part of the arable land will be used for other purposes, e.g.
forestry. In total, approx. 390.000 hectares will be taken out of agricultural
production. The funding that has been set aside for this initiative is 5,7 billion EUR.
And lastly, more than 10 % of the agricultural land will be transformed into nature.
Based on the agreement, we believe we have made a huge step towards achieving
good ecological status in coastal waterbodies by the end of 2027. Prior to 2027, we
expect to be on target with the implementation of the necessary nitrogen measures

with respect to the majority of all coastal waters in accordance with the Water
Framework Directive.
As for the remaining coastal waters, the measures will be initiated already by 2024
and 2025 and carried out continuously before 2030.
We realize that this is past the 2027-deadline. However, the scale of the task is so
significant that a longer-term plan is necessary. It is not possible to reach the
objectives for the remainder of the coastal waters before the end of 2027.
Additional measures for the other parts of the 3rd RBMP, i.e. water courses, lakes
and groundwater, have been decided at the political level. This means that new and
additional measures will be implemented in order to comply with the Water
Framework Directive. Thus, Denmark is spending more than 345 million EUR on
water courses, lakes and groundwater during the planning period for the 3rd RBMP
alone.
The updated plans ensure restoration of additional 2.000 km water courses and
removal of 750 barriers. Combined with the measures already introduced in stage 1
of the 3
rd
RBMP, the 3rd RBMP restores 7.500 water courses and removes approx.
1.500 barriers. In the revisit it has also been decided to address the problematic
situation with phosphorous in lakes. The current phosphors ceilings will be lowered
with 1 kg/hectare annually in 2025 and 2026. In 2027, a new phosphorus regulation
will be decided upon.
It is not possible to ensure that all measures have been implemented before 2027.
Instead, a plan that outlines the measures that will be implemented in 2033 and
later has been agreed upon. Like on coastal waters, this is not in compliance with
the directive. Therefore, we look forward to the structured dialogue the Commission
will initiate on the handling of the areas where we do not expect to reach good status
by 2027.
The updated plans will now undergo a second public consultation for a period of 6
months. Thus, the plans will not be fully operational until, expectedly, October
2025. We will of course continue to update you and your staff on the progress with
the revisit of the River Basin Management Plans.
